Go, Speed Racer, Go!
Photo by John Shanks
With the new movie catching the interest of a new generation, let's check back in on Drag Racing's own Speed Racer...
In 1976, Steve Harris debuted chassis builder Mike Kase's "Speed Racer" Vega at the OCIR annual Manufacturers Meet. In 1977, following an injury to Harris, Tom Anderson, who had been racing his own Vega and "Wild Thing" Mustang II F/C took over the reins. By 78 team was on a roll, winning the Div 3 title, taking runner up at Cajun Nationals and finishing 6th in NHRA points. However, lady luck didn't smile on the team in 79 as they seemed to just miss qualifying at most NHRA national events. Speed Racer closed out the decade as an Omni bodied car and in early 1980, Anderson left the team to crew chief on Len Imbrogno's Centurion Trans Am and "AA/Dale" Armstrong took over driving chores. In 81 Armstrong became the 6th member of the Cragar 5 Second Club with a 5.98 at the Gatornationals. Anderson later went on to drive for Jim Wemett.
Info thanks to 70sfunnycars.com